Libartnet - A Linux ArtNet Library

Project Page (including download links)

libartnet is a implementation of the ArtNet protocol designed for POSIX systems. It's known to work on Linux, and since 0.1.10 has been working on Mac OS X.

The current sources can be fetched using git:

$ git clone http://www.nomis52.net/git/libartnet $ git clone http://www.nomis52.net/git/artnet-examples

Examples

libartnet comes with the following example programs:

artnet_discover

artnet_discover displays configuration info on all the ArtNet nodes currently on the network

artnet_dmxconsole

This is a hack on dmxconsole from DMX4Linux so that it sends data over ArtNet rather than to /dev/dmx0

ArtNet DMX Console

artnet_usb

This uses the Enttec Open DMX USB Interface to act as an ArtNet to DMX node.

artnet_rdm_output

Example of how to act as an RDM output gateway

artnet_firmware_node / artnet_firmware_server

These demonstrate how to transfer firmware images.
